Bevovations, LLC Recall: Product contains high levels of patulin (above 50ppb).

Recalled products
Product description UPC Quantity Lot / code information
1/2 gallon CN Smith brand Apple Cider; 1/2 gallon and 16 oz. Wilson Farms brand Apple Cider; 1 gallon, 1/2 gallon, and 16 oz. Carlson Orchards brand Apple Cider - all packaged in HDPE bottles and shipped in corrugated closed boxes. Not published in this source record 565 cases total. Wilson: 43 cases distributed (per ATT B). Carlsons: 510 cases distributed (per ATT B). CN Smith: 12 cases distributed (per ATT B). Lot Code 171 Best By August 4, 2023.

What does a Class II mean?

A situation in which use of or exposure to a product may cause temporary or medically reversible adverse health consequences, or where the probability of serious consequences is remote.
